识别ArUco码的无人机降落原理
时间: 2023-06-27 08:03:21 浏览: 320
ArUco码是一种基于二维条形码的视觉标记系统,可以用于无人机导航和定位。无人机识别ArUco码并降落的原理如下:
1. 无人机搭载摄像头,拍摄下面的地面,检测是否有ArUco码。
2. 如果检测到了ArUco码,无人机会通过计算机视觉算法计算出相机与码之间的距离和角度,确定无人机的位置和姿态。
3. 根据无人机当前位置和目标位置之间的距离和角度差异,无人机会自动调整姿态和高度,直到与地面平齐并且垂直降落到目标位置。
4. 如果无人机检测不到ArUco码,它将继续搜索周围环境,直到找到目标位置为止。
需要注意的是,识别ArUco码并降落的过程中,无人机需要依靠计算机视觉算法实时计算位置和姿态,因此需要高效的硬件和算法支持。
相关问题
无人机 降落 aruco
Aruco是一种基于机器视觉技术的二维码,常用于无人机的定位和识别。通过在无人机上安装相应的视觉传感器和摄像头,可以实现对Aruco标记的检测和识别,从而实现无人机的自主导航和降落。
具体操作步骤如下:
1. 在起飞场地周围设置Aruco标记,标记的位置和编号需要预先记录下来。
2. 无人机起飞后,通过相应的定位算法获取当前位置和方向信息。
3. 无人机飞行到指定位置附近时,开启Aruco标记检测功能,识别周围的标记并获取其编号。
4. 根据预先记录的标记编号和位置,计算出无人机当前位置和降落点之间的距离和方向。
5. 控制无人机按照计算出的方向和距离缓慢降落,直到成功降落在指定的位置。
需要注意的是,Aruco标记的识别和定位精度会受到光照、标记大小和距离等因素的影响,需要根据实际情况进行调整和优化。同时,无人机降落过程中需要保持稳定和平缓,避免碰撞和损坏。
无人机识别二维码降落原理
无人机识别二维码降落的原理可以分为以下几个步骤:
1. 二维码扫描:无人机上搭载了摄像头和相关的图像识别算法,可以对飞行过程中所经过的场景进行实时拍摄和处理。当无人机飞行到指定的降落区域时,它会扫描降落区域上的二维码。
2. 二维码识别:通过图像识别算法对二维码进行解码,获得二维码所携带的信息。
3. 位置定位:根据二维码所携带的信息,无人机可以确定自己在降落区域的位置和朝向。
4. 降落控制:无人机根据自身位置和朝向,通过控制飞行器的动力系统,实现安全降落。
需要注意的是,无人机识别二维码降落的实现需要高精度的定位和控制技术,同时还需要对图像处理和识别算法进行优化,以确保实时性和准确性。
阅读全文